Unlike many under-the-radar brokers, Precious Properties has done a very nice job with the photos in this listing for 240 Dean Street in Boerum Hill. Nonetheless, we continue to be amazed that sellers opt for the inferior marketing reach of outfits like this. After all, it’s our job to keep an eye out for listings like this and it us over a month to come across this one. The two-family Victorian hit the market in mid-April with a price tag of $1,595,000 and was reduced last week to $1,499,000. While a little on the narrow side, we were positively impressed with the condition and aesthetics of the interiors. We’d think this would be attracting interest at this level. Is it a matter of low visibility or are we being overly optimistic about the price?
